Competence profile of headteachers and their in-service training
Bareš, Milan ; Trojan, Václav (advisor) ; Voda, Jan (referee)
The thesis deals with the issues of headteachers' vocational competences and their needs for in-service training. The issue is assessed with regard to school degree and a phase of headmaster's career. The thesis is based on the need to clearly define what knowledge, abilities and attitudes should headteachers have to be able to manage the school successfully. This is also one of the conditions for creating a meaningful career system in schooling and a basis for a systematic further vocational development of headteachers. The thesis suggests a generic top performance profile of headteachers of all school degrees and a structure of their in-service training which corresponds to necessary competence. As a result, this should lead to an improvement of vocational training of headteachers and subsequently to higher quality of schools they manage.

Regelation of patterned ground in the High Tatras.
Pechačová, Blanka ; Křížek, Marek (advisor) ; Voják, Karel (referee)
Regelation (freeze-thaw cycles) is the collective term used for a process of alternate freezing and thawing of water and solutions into the soil or bedrock. The series of geomorphological and pedological processes such as migration of soil water, formation of segregated ice or frost heaving, is connected with regelation. Condition of freezing-thawing process is a phase transition of water that leads to an important phenomenon - a release or consumption of latent heat. This phenomenon can be observed from the data obtained by measuring the temperature in the soil profile. In the present bachelor thesis, here are investigated sites of sorted patterned ground (Hincovo pleso, Lučné sedlo) and earth hummocks (Kopské sedlo) in the High Tatras for the purposes of the study regelation process. In addition to detailed description of the physical-geomorphological processes associated with phase changes of water in patterned groud, the main aim of the thesis is to set regelation cycles and their characteristics using different methods for determination of regelation on the basis of temperature measurements in patterned groug of the foregoing locations. Application of econometric and simulation models in organizing a running race
Mihál, Filip ; Kuncová, Martina (advisor) ; Novotný, Jakub (referee)
This diploma thesis deals with application of econometric and simulation models in organizing relay running race od Tatier k Dunaju. In theoretical part the reader is introduced to basic theory regarding econometric and simulation models. Detailed introduction to od Tatier k Dunaju running race follows afterwards. There are used multiple regression models in this thesis which are used to estimate runner s time in his sector based on 10 km run reported time and track profile. Results are compared to those provided by organizer himself and between each other. Simulation models are used to analyze sufficiency of parking lots capacity, which are used by team cars while traveling between sectors. These models are compared to reality and afterwards suggestions to solve recognized issues are discussed.

Portable and Miniaturized Separation Techniques Applicable for Food and Biotechnology Analysis
Dvořák, Miloš ; Pospíchal, Jan (referee) ; Bednář,, Petr (referee) ; Rittich, Bohuslav (advisor)
Capillary electrophoresis was used for determination of 6 fractions of caseins. Those fractions were measured in 144 samples of cow’s milk originated from the feeding experiment focused on explanation the influence of the feeding onto casein productions. In this work were separated 6 fraction of caseins first time with total resolution of the peaks. Capillary electrophoresis was applied for determination of short-chain organic acids during fermentation of wine must. It was compared the fermentation of must fermented by different yeast. The difference of profile short-chain organic acids during fermentation were not statistically significant. The once difference was in the utilisation of the malic acid and production of the lactic acid. A portable miniaturized system for medium pressure liquid chromatography was developed. The components were tested and system was used for the isocratic and gradient elution of various analytes (food dyes, parabens). New line of electroluminescent diodes (LEDs) for deep-UV areas of wavelength based on a different materials substrate was characterised. The new line was compared with old line LEDs. The new line LEDs was incorporated in deep-UV absorbance detectors. Detectors were characterised and tested for a detection various analytes in modes flow injection analysis and chromatography separation. First time was characterised this new line of the LEDs and the origin of the parasitic emission band produced by deep-UV LEDs light sources was explained. This origin is given by disturbances of a materials substrates. This work is a contribution for an advance of low-cost and portable systems and detection devices in the field of analytical chemistry.

Analysis of runoff in selected urban watershed
Kučera, Vít ; Máca, Petr (advisor) ; Petr, Petr (referee)
The work deals with schematization area with sewage networks in the Rainfalls-runoff model urbanized watershed modeling and changes in the Manning roughness coefficient of the pipe to the main sewer, which drains most of the wastewater. The comparison was made on two schematization basin Bohnice collector the main sewer F in the city. Prague. For the simulation program was used Mike URBAN DHI Inc.
The main variable was observed outflow hydrograph on the selected sealing profile watershed and its development depending on schematization and change the Manning roughness coefficient.

Chosen Destination Potencial on the Tourism Industry Market in the Czech Republic
Béna, Tomáš ; Navrátilová, Miroslava (advisor) ; Zuzana, Zuzana (referee)
The diploma thesis deals with the field of tourism industry. After a general definition of a broader context and key terms, the basic theoretical approaches to assessing the potential of tourism and the division of its assumptions are evaluated and compared, as well as its typology is outlined. Subsequently, the investigated destination of Podzvičinsko is defined territorially, and the studied theoretical approaches are applied in its description and a detailed inventory of attractions. Further, structured interviews with experts were conducted. The next step was to compile a questionnaire and its distribution to the wider public in order to find out data about potential visitors. On the basis of the provided information, the participants were divided into respective target segments. Specific tourism products have been designed for these segments which maximally correspond to the segments profiles, their goals and possibilities. The findings identified during the structured interviews and in the questionnaires also defined negatively perceived aspects of the destination, and measures were proposed for their improvement.
